Is Audi discontinuing the S5 convertible?

While the four-door Sportback model will be offered for 2025, the two door coupe and Cabriolet models will no longer be available. The two-door versions of the Audi A5, S5, and RS5 will not make it to the 2025 model year. Both the coupe and Cabriolet models will be dead, but the four-door Sportback survives into 2025. Audi confirmed the news while showing the new A5 and S5 to members of the media in Munich, Germany, this week. Honestly, it makes sense — the two-door variants are super-low-volume sellers, so there’s really no sense in taking the time and effort to engineer new versions. Is the Audi S5 expensive to maintain?

An Audi S5 Coupe will cost about $10,422 for maintenance and repairs during its first 10 years of service. This beats the industry average for luxury coupe models by $2,017. There is also a 29. S5 Coupe will require a major repair during that time. Audis can go up to 200,000 miles or 20 years without major repairs when they’re properly maintained.
